Weir is a type of business that specializes in water management. The term "weir" refers to a barrier across a river designed to alter its flow characteristics. In the context of a business, Weir would be a company that designs, constructs, maintains, or operates these structures.
Weir businesses play a crucial role in water management, which is a branch of environmental management focusing on the control of water resources. This includes water quality, water supply, flood control, and irrigation. These

companies may work closely with government entities, as water resources often fall under public jurisdiction.
The services offered by a Weir business can vary. They may provide consulting services, helping to plan and design water management strategies. They may also be involved in the construction and maintenance of weirs and other water control structures. Some Weir businesses may also offer services related to water treatment and purification.
In addition, these companies may also be involved in research and development, creating new technologies and methods for managing water resources more effectively. They may also provide education and training services, helping to increase awareness and understanding of water management issues.
In summary, a Weir business is a company that specializes in the management of water resources, particularly through the use of weirs and other similar structures. They play a crucial role in ensuring the sustainable and efficient use of water resources.

1. Incident and Event Monitoring
Automation: Automatically collect, consolidate, and report on weir-related incidents (e.g., overflows, damage reports, sensor alerts) by pulling data from IoT sensors or manual entries, triggering alerts, and generating summary reports for stakeholders.
Benefits: Reduces response time to critical events, ensures regulatory compliance, and enhances situational awareness.
---
2. Maintenance Scheduling and Tracking
Automation: Schedule routine inspections and maintenance based on predefined intervals, water levels, or sensor triggers. Notify responsible personnel, log completed tasks, and follow up on overdue activities.
Benefits: Reduces equipment downtime, prevents failures, and maintains compliance with safety standards.
---
3. Compliance and Regulatory Reporting
Automation: Consolidate monitoring data (e.g., water flow, contamination levels) from multiple sources and automatically generate compliance reports tailored for government agencies.
Benefits: Saves staff time, reduces risk of non-compliance, and ensures accurate, consistent records.
---
4. Stakeholder Communication
Automation: Send automatic updates to community stakeholders, government officials, or internal teams about ongoing projects, incidents, and scheduled maintenance via email or SMS.
Benefits: Improves transparency, keeps all parties informed, and demonstrates accountability.
---
5. Water Level and Flow Data Integration
Automation: Automatically collect, process, and display real-time water levels and flow rates from weirs using sensor integrations; trigger notifications if thresholds are exceeded.
Benefits: Prevents flooding events, supports data-driven decision-making, and maintains public safety.
---
6. Permit and Document Management
Automation: Track permits, regulatory documents, renewals, and automate reminders for upcoming expirations and required submissions.
Benefits: Avoids lapses in permits, reduces legal risk, and streamlines compliance management.
---
7. Invoice and Financial Workflow Automation
Automation: Automate creation, approval, and tracking of vendor invoices and payments related to water management projects and maintenance costs.
Benefits: Accelerates financial processes and provides clear audit trails.
---
8. Project Progress and Task Tracking
Automation: Monitor project milestones, assign tasks, track completion, and generate progress reports for internal management and external reporting.
Benefits: Improves project delivery times and provides clarity on project status.
